B257B, B257C AMBIENT SENSOR
B257B, B257C AMBIENT SENSOR
Description
INFOID:0000000003884740
COMPONENT DESCRIPTION
Ambient Sensor
• The ambient sensor (1) is installed behind left side of front bumper.
• It detects ambient temperature and converts it into a resistance
value which is then input into the A/C auto amp.
Ambient Sensor Circuit
AMBIENT TEMPERATURE INPUT PROCESS
The A/C auto amp. equips a processing circuit for the ambient sensor input. However, when the temperature
detected by the ambient sensor increases quickly, the processing circuit retards the A/C auto amp. function. It
only allows the A/C auto amp. to recognize an ambient temperature increase of 0.33
°
C (0.6
°
F) per 100 sec-
onds.
As an example, consider stopping for a few minutes after high speed driving. Although the actual ambient tem-
perature has not changed, the temperature detected by the ambient sensor increases. This is because the
heat from the engine compartment can radiate to the front bumper area, the location of the ambient sensor.

Diagnosis Procedure
INFOID:0000000003884742
1.
CHECK VOLTAGE BETWEEN AMBIENT SENSOR AND GROUND
1.
Disconnect ambient sensor connector.
2.
Turn ignition switch ON.
3.
Check voltage between ambient sensor harness connector and ground.
Is the inspection result normal?
YES
>> GO TO 2.
NO
>> GO TO 4.
2.
CHECK CIRCUIT CONTINUITY BETWEEN AMBIENT SENSOR AND A/C AUTO AMP.
1.
Turn ignition switch OFF.
2.
Disconnect A/C auto amp. connector.
3.
Check continuity between ambient sensor harness connector and A/C auto amp. harness connector.
Is the inspection result normal?
YES
>> GO TO 3.
NO
>> Repair harness or connector.
3.
CHECK AMBIENT SENSOR
Check ambient sensor. Refer to
HAC-168, "Component Inspection"
Is the inspection result normal?
YES
>> Replace A/C auto amp.
NO
>> Replace ambient sensor.
